## Notes — Mailwick bounce processor incident follow-up

Discussed last week's backlog in the Mailwick bounce processor. Root cause: a schema change upstream broke the bounce parser, and failures piled up silently in the retry queue for six hours. Agreed actions: add schema validation at ingest, alert when queue depth exceeds 10k, and document the manual drain procedure in the runbook. On-call should page out rather than drain solo during business hours. Escalation path for future bounce incidents goes directly to the engineer listed below.

account owner for bawip-tahag: Raleth Quenok

Ticket: Sealed vault blocking baseline update

The static-analysis baseline file for the Lintmarsh scanner lives in the Coldkeep vault, which auto-sealed after three failed unlock attempts during last night's CI run. We need a security reviewer to approve reopening before we can regenerate suppressions. Per procedure, the recovery passphrase for the unseal step is recorded immediately below.

vault phrase of hahop-badug = novvan-ulaion-zorius-noviel-gorwyn-casix-tamys

Handover: GraphQL N+1 fix (Ordersphere)

Hey — wrapping up before the eng sync. The N+1 on the orders-to-shipments resolver is fixed with a dataloader batch; latency on the Tallow staging env dropped from 900ms to 120ms. One gotcha: the batcher config lives in the sealed settings vault, and I rotated its lock last week while testing. If anyone needs to tweak batch sizes before the sync, unlock the vault with the recovery passphrase below.

vault phrase of bagaf-kajeg = jorath-feniel-briir-siliel-ralix